Antonio Lope: Appa was born tn Jalappa, Peprnary 2 2k Ts He took a gallant part in 1821 in the war for in- sependence, and in the pext year was named Governor of Vera Cruz. Soon after iuvelved in a struggle with leurbide,whom he overthrew in 1523. sieve icipated in all the political movements of the stormy period which followed. In 1829 became com- mander-in-chief of the army, and in 1833 was chosen President. In 1€35 he crushed a fed- eral revolt and prociaimed himself Dictator. In 1536 be was captured by the Texans under Gen. Houston. From 154i to 1844 be was vir- tually Dictator. Im 185 he was banished for & term of ten years. He returned two years later to conduct the campaign againat General Taylor. In 1645 he left Mexico again. bat re- turned im 1853. After a presidency of two years he signed a perpetual abdication, and sailed forHavana With his subsequent bistory our readers are familial FINANCIAL. The reduction of force in the offices of the (Quartermaster General and Commissary Gen" eral ts partly in cousequence of the appropria- sion for temporary clerks being exhausted, and partly in consequence of the cessation of tae necessity for employment of additional cleri- cal force. Quartermaster’s mopey, property, And clothing accounts, accumulated so Tapidly during the war that not even the jarge force employed could keep up the work, and the settiement of such accounts was twoto bree years behind hand when the war closed. At present the number of accounts received is very small comparatively, and the work in arrear bas been brought up nearer to date. RECONSTRUCTION.—The bill supplementary to the reconstruction act, which was intro- duced into the House yesterday by Mr. Spal- ding, and referred to the Select Committee on Recoustruction, provides that the military offi- cers assigned to the command of the five dis- tricts are invested with authority to govern their respective districts as th erning power therein. until such times as said districts or the component parts thereof shill be received by Congress into the Federal Union as States, subject to the restrictions and limitations hereinafter mentiones, namely: the military officers. being once assigned to the command of their respective districts, shall continue in such command until suspended, superceded, or removed by the President upou the express recommendation of the General-in- Chief of the armies of the United States, with | the assent of the Secretary of War. Tbe mili- tary officers shall have power to remove from Office or snepend trom duty all persons exer- cising official functions. whether civil or mili- tary. under any authority derived from the people of said district, and to sppoint others in their places, to hold their offices during the pieasure of snch military commanders. Among | ; other sections is one that no executive, legis. lative, oF judicial power sought to be estab- lished or recognized imany of the military dis- tricts, except the same be derived from the Government of the United States aud express- ly sanctioned by Congress, shall be of any | foree or validity against the rules and orders | ot the military officer commanding the district ‘This act is to take effect om its passage. and re- main in force until said rebellious communi. | ties embraced in said military districts shail | severally be admitted, by act of Congress, | into the Federal Union as States, under and | by virtue of the several acts of reconstruction passed by Congress Nomination ations being sent to the Senate during the presen: s¢-sion of Uongress, in view ef the purposes expressed by resolutions, &c., in that body, as to the special character of busi- to be transacted only before final sd- jouymament.
